Transaction 671f10481be2591b5bce49c6dabadb1cc8349744dee2da6a34760dcc7a44c0d1
1 Input
1 Output
-
671f10481be2591b5bce49c6dabadb1cc8349744dee2da6a34760dcc7a44c0d1:0
- value
- 26810559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90363696aca1335406c8a0d1d34756f6e0eddb6b OP_EQUAL
- address
- 3EqYAyA8z4vAjEZJgsx53Ny9sC5Rd63px9